An OB-GYN surgeon has posted a laparoscopic partial hysterectomy and has informed the surgical team that the ovaries are remaining. However, the fallopian tubes will require ligation involving the tubes being clipped and cauterized. Which of the following instruments should the surgical technologist open? A. a Filshie and a Kleppinger B. a harmonic scalpel and hemoclip applier C. a Filshie and hemoclip applier D. a Kleppinger and harmonic scalpel A. a Filshie and a Kleppinger Rationale: A Filshie is a small titanium clip with a soft lining used specifically for female sterilization. The Kleppinger would be used next as a secondary measure to cauterize the exposed ends of the Fallopian tubes. A harmonic scalpel is used to cut and coagulate tissue, but the Kleppinger offers a smaller, more precise coagulation area. Hemoclip appliers are not used as a sterilization method. When transferring a patient to the operation room table, the surgical technologist should A. power off any medical equipment during the transfer. B. ensure that the O.R table remains unlocked in order to position the table to the surgeon's preference. C. allow 5-6 fingerbreadths between the safety strap and the patient. D. transfer medical equipment first and then move the patient. D. transfer medical equipment first and then move the patient. Rationale: Powering off medical equipment could harm the patient. Unlocked operating room tables increase the patients risk for injury. The safety strap should be snug for the safety of the patient without causing injury.
